Why a Home Maintenance Timeline Report is Your Selling Secret Weapon

Buyers aren’t buying walls and roofs—they’re buying confidence. A simple timeline proves your home’s been loved: “New roof in 2022 by ABC Roofing for $12K” or “Kitchen upgrade in 2020 by XYZ Pros, $15K spent.” Without it, vague claims lead to lowballs and contingencies. With it? Faster sales (20-30% quicker, per NAR data) and higher prices.

Step 1: Sign Up and Add Your Property (5 Minutes) – Set the Stage for Your Timeline

What to Do: Go to bodie.io, sign up for Bodie Basic, and create your account. From Dashboard > Properties, click [+ Add Property]. Enter basics: address (street, city, state, postal code), year built, and a quick property description (e.g., “Cozy 3-bed with recent upgrades”). Add a property main image if handy.

Why It Adds Value: This anchors your timeline to one home, making reports laser-focused. For sellers, it contextualizes spends—like showing upgrades in a 1,800 sq ft family home. Skip the fluff; it’s quick setup for property maintenance software ease.

Pro Tip: If you have a home office space, note sq ft in user settings for tax tie-ins later.

Step 2: Log Your Key Expenses and Repairs (10-20 Minutes) – Build the “What, When, Who, How Much” Data

What to Do: Head to Dashboard > Expense Records. For each major item (focus on last 5-10 years for resale):

  • Click [+ Add New].
  • Link to your property.
  • Select maintenance-record category (e.g., Roofing, Plumbing).
  • Add description (what was done: “Full roof replacement with asphalt shingles”).
  • Set maintenance date (when: YYYY-MM-DD).
  • Enter vendor or service provider (who: “ABC Roofing Inc., contact: 555-1234”).
  • Input amount paid (how much: $12,500.00).
  • Optional: Mark tax category (e.g., Energy for solar) and upload a linked document (receipt photo or PDF).

Add 5-10 entries to start—prioritize big-ticket upgrades and recent fixes.

Why It Adds Value: This populates your timeline with facts, not guesses. Buyers see proactive care (e.g., “No major issues since 2019”), reducing objections.
